Monarch Athletic Club is bringing its physician-led wellness concept to Miami Beach, marking its first East Coast location inside Robert Rivani’s flagship Class X office development, The RIVANI Miami Beach. The 8,000-square-foot facility at 1691 Michigan Avenue will introduce Monarch’s signature model that integrates medicine, fitness, and recovery under one roof, providing members with access to a coordinated team of physicians, trainers, and specialists focused on performance, prevention, and longevity.

Founded by Dr. Ryan Greene, DO, MS, and Paul Freschi, Monarch has earned a strong following in Los Angeles for its proactive, data-driven approach to health. “Miami brings a unique energy and unmatched appetite for community, wellness, and longevity,” said Dr. Greene. “It’s the perfect place to expand our ecosystem and help people thrive through a model of care that keeps them strong and well.”

Members at Monarch receive comprehensive medical evaluations, unlimited personal training, physical therapy, IV therapy, hormone and peptide optimization, and advanced recovery treatments such as infrared saunas and ice baths—all within one membership experience. The club’s integrated design reflects a shift toward preventative, high-performance wellness rather than reactive treatment.
For Rivani, the partnership reflects his vision for redefining the modern workplace. “Monarch Athletic Club is a game changer for Miami’s wellness scene,” he said. “Their innovation and elite services represent the caliber of tenants we’re curating at The RIVANI, aligning perfectly with our focus on lifestyle and wellbeing.”

Designed by Rockwell Group, The RIVANI Miami Beach blends luxury design, hospitality-level service, and cutting-edge technology to create a new global standard for office environments. Monarch Athletic Club is expected to open in 2026, continuing Rivani’s mission to transform Miami’s business landscape into one centered around health, experience, and performance.
